Paradise's energy comes from Natural Gas, Nuclear, Coal, Wind, Petroleum, Hydroelectric, and Solar. Natural Gas is the largest source of electricity, providing 42% of Paradise's energy. Nuclear is the second largest source, making up 25%. Coal provides 19% of the energy in Paradise. Wind provides 10% of the energy in Paradise. Petroleum provides 1% of the energy in Paradise. Hydroelectric provides 1% of the energy in Paradise. Solar provides 1% of the energy in Paradise.

Net metering policies in Paradise can help solar panel owners save money and reduce their carbon footprint. When your solar panels generate more electricity than you use, you can send the excess back to the grid and receive credit on your next bill.
